4Prem Anand

Went for dinner buffet. Good number of spreads. Salads and desserts were excellent. Main course was good. Had dosa from live counter which was outstanding. Curd rice vathakulambu and tomato rasam were top notch. Non veg spreads were limited when compared with veg. Mutton with drum stick gravy Is a must try. Prawn thokku tasted sweet.Personally, i did not like the taste of Briyanis.Overall a good food .

4Lithika J

I visited the newly relaunched Madras Pavilion for their Saturday buffet, and the experience had a clear high point. The dessert section has improved beautifully, with cheesecakes, macarons, mousse, and many other treats that genuinely felt premium and delicious. However, the main food didn’t deliver the same satisfaction. The biryani, which is often praised, didn’t work for me this time, and a few other dishes felt average. I feel the food section can definitely be enhanced, just like the impressive upgrade seen in the desserts. Overall, an amazing dessert experience with room for improvement in the main spread.

4Yogita Uchil

The all-new Madras Pavilion at a ITC grand chola,is now open! What I instantly loved about the space are its fresh new colours and bright, cheerful tones. The food counters are thoughtfully organised and beautifully spaced out, with a menu that feels both well-curated and inviting. My favourite corner, the one celebrating millets, is a lovely addition that truly enhances the overall dining experience. There’s also an all-new cocktail menu, and I must say, The Jasmine was my personal favourite. And as always, the dessert counters brought out the child in me — my eyes were darting around even before the sugar rush kicked in!
